Methods 命名转换:send\u autoreply()与send\u auto\u reply()的比较

Methods 命名转换:send\u autoreply()与send\u auto\u reply()的比较,methods,naming-conventions,Methods,Naming Conventions,哪个方法名更好,为什么 send\u autoreply() send\u auto\u reply() 如果使用snake案例命名约定,我更喜欢使用发送自动回复(),因为: 它帮助您坚持snake_case命名标准(它看起来更像代码中的其他变量/函数名) 对于其他类似的情况,将不会有语法方面的问题,因为按照这个简单的标准,您不会犯语法错误 如果您有一个与手动回复相反的函数,那么正确的名称应该是send\u manual\u reply(),这样有助于保持一致性 我的回答有用吗?是的。抱歉耽

哪个方法名更好,为什么

  • send\u autoreply()
  • send\u auto\u reply()

如果使用snake案例命名约定,我更喜欢使用
发送自动回复()
,因为:

  • 它帮助您坚持snake_case命名标准(它看起来更像代码中的其他变量/函数名)
  • 对于其他类似的情况,将不会有语法方面的问题,因为按照这个简单的标准,您不会犯语法错误
  • 如果您有一个与手动回复相反的函数,那么正确的名称应该是
    send\u manual\u reply()
    ,这样有助于保持一致性

我的回答有用吗?是的。抱歉耽搁了。